Anna Towle in the US
We found 1 people named Anna Towle with email addresses, mobile phone numbers, USA home addresses and more.
Anna E Towle
Residents of 51 N 100 E, Roosevelt, UT include Anna
Address:
51 N 100 E, Roosevelt, UT 84066
Report ID:
626d16ad18e7bc5b3961a89e
View Background Report Now!
Best Sites To Do Background Checks
Best Sites To Do Background Checks